Protect Your Blood Vessels With These Ingredients

Learn about the best ingredients that can help protect the blood vessels and reduce the risk of developing heart disease and other severe conditions

The cardiovascular system is one of the most vital systems in the human body, and blood vessels play an essential role in it.

These thin tubes carry blood from the heart to all parts of the body and provide oxygen and nutrients that the cells need to function correctly. The condition of your blood vessels can significantly impact your health, and damaged vessels can lead to severe problems, including heart disease and stroke.

Fortunately, there are several ways to keep the blood vessels healthy, including incorporating specific ingredients into your diet. Here are some of the best ingredients that can help you protect your blood vessels.

1. Flavonoids

Flavonoids are a group of plant compounds that have antioxidant properties and provide various health benefits.

Several studies have shown that flavonoids can help protect the blood vessels from damage and prevent inflammation, which is a leading cause of many chronic conditions, including heart disease.

Some of the best sources of flavonoids include:.

  • Dark Chocolate
  • Citrus fruits
  • Green tea
  • Red wine
  • Blueberries, raspberries, and strawberries

2. Omega-3 Fatty Acids

Omega-3 fatty acids are a type of unsaturated fat that have several health benefits. They can help reduce inflammation, lower blood pressure, and improve cholesterol levels, which are all essential factors for maintaining healthy blood vessels.

Some of the best sources of omega-3 fatty acids include:.

  • Salmon, mackerel, and other fatty fish
  • Chia seeds and flaxseeds
  • Walnuts
  • Soybeans and tofu

3. Garlic

Garlic is a popular ingredient in many dishes and has been used medicinally for centuries.

It contains several compounds that have been shown to improve heart health, including reducing blood pressure, lowering cholesterol levels, and preventing blood clotting.

Studies have also found that garlic can help improve the function of blood vessels and reduce the risk of plaque buildup in the arteries.

4. Pomegranate

Pomegranate is a fruit that is rich in antioxidants, including flavonoids and polyphenols.

Studies have found that consuming pomegranate juice can help improve the function of blood vessels and reduce inflammation, which are essential factors for maintaining healthy blood vessels.

One study even found that drinking pomegranate juice daily for three months helped reduce blood pressure and improve the function of blood vessels in patients with high blood pressure.

5. Berries

Berries are a great source of antioxidants, including anthocyanins, which have been shown to protect the blood vessels from damage and improve cardiovascular health.

Some of the best berries to include in your diet include:.

  • Blueberries
  • Raspberries
  • Strawberries
  • Blackberries

6. Nuts and Seeds

Nuts and seeds are a great source of unsaturated fats, fiber, and protein, making them an excellent addition to any healthy diet.

They also contain several nutrients that can help protect the blood vessels, including vitamin E, magnesium, and potassium.

Some of the best nuts and seeds to include in your diet include:.

  • Almonds
  • Walnuts
  • Chia Seeds
  • Flaxseeds
  • Sunflower Seeds

7. Green Leafy Vegetables

Green leafy vegetables are an excellent source of several essential vitamins and minerals, including vitamin C, vitamin K, and folate.

They are also rich in antioxidants and other compounds that can help protect the blood vessels and improve cardiovascular health.

Some of the best green leafy vegetables to include in your diet include:.

  • Kale
  • Spinach
  • Collard Greens
  • Swiss Chard

8. Tomatoes

Tomatoes are a great source of lycopene, an antioxidant that has been shown to reduce inflammation and protect the blood vessels from damage.

Some studies have also found that consuming tomatoes can help improve blood pressure and reduce the risk of heart disease.

9. Beetroot

Beetroot is a root vegetable that is packed with nutrients, including folate, iron, and antioxidants.

Studies have found that consuming beetroot can help improve the function of blood vessels and reduce blood pressure, making it an excellent ingredient for maintaining a healthy cardiovascular system.

10. Turmeric

Turmeric is a spice that is commonly used in Indian and Middle Eastern cuisine. It contains a compound called curcumin that has been shown to have anti-inflammatory properties and can help protect the blood vessels from damage.

Research has also found that consuming turmeric may help improve cardiovascular health by reducing cholesterol levels and preventing blood clotting.

Final Thoughts

Maintaining healthy blood vessels is crucial for overall health and wellbeing. Incorporating these ingredients into your diet can help protect your blood vessels and reduce the risk of developing heart disease and other severe conditions.

Additionally, following a healthy diet, getting regular exercise, and avoiding smoking and excessive alcohol consumption can all help support healthy blood vessels and improve cardiovascular health.
